+ if (typeof CanvasPixelArray !== 'undefined' && data instanceof CanvasPixelArray) {
+ // IE10/IE11: Canvases are backed by the deprecated CanvasPixelArray,
+ // not UInt8ClampedArray. These don't have buffers, so we need to revert
+ // to copying a byte at a time. We do the undefined check because modern
+ // browsers do not define CanvasPixelArray anymore.
+ src = buffer;
+ num = data.length;
+ while (dst < num) {
+ data[dst++] = HEAP8[src++];
+ }
